An FAA safety alert issued last week–SAFO 14005–urges flight department managers to raise awareness of flap misconfiguration events during all training programs. While such misconfigurations are rare, they do occur, according to the Aviation Safety Information Analysis and Sharing program, which looked at crew attempts to depart with no flap deployment, as well as takeoffs during which the crew corrected a flap misconfiguration while accelerating down the runway.

The alert said it is imperative that pilots exercise proper checklist discipline to prevent takeoff misconfiguration and added, “Approximately half of the misconfiguration events…resulted in rejected takeoffs. In others the takeoffs were continued and the flaps were moved during the takeoff roll.”
